Exploring the theme of death in Gothic literature, this comprehensive study examines how representations of mortality evolved from 1740 to 1914. It draws on a variety of popular Gothic and Victorian works, including novels, poems, and short stories, to analyze the cultural and literary significance of death during this period. This in-depth analysis reveals the intricate ways in which these texts reflect societal attitudes toward dying and the afterlife, offering fresh insights into the Gothic genre.
